Lost-badge procedure (reception copy). When a member of staff at Oakhallow Systems reports a lost badge, first verify their identity against the photo directory, then deactivate the badge in the Doorwright console before doing anything else. Log the incident in the daily register and issue a one-day visitor lanyard. If the console is offline, admit them through the side door using the code below.

turnstile pass: bdg-TXR-4

// COMPACTION_LAG_MAX controls how far behind the Quillbus broker's
// log compactor may fall before alerts fire. Support: if customers
// report stale tombstones or resurrected keys, check compactor lag
// first. Compaction runs per-partition; a stuck partition blocks
// cleanup for that key range only. Do not raise this value to
// silence alerts — it widens the window where deleted records
// remain readable. Lowering it increases broker IO. When escalating
// a compaction issue, include the token printed below.

trace token, fafog-kageg: htk4_98e6

## Authentication

Heads up: the nightly reindex job (`reindex_nightly.py`) talks to the Lanternfish search cluster, and that cluster won't accept anonymous writes anymore — we locked it down last sprint. The job now authenticates as the `reindex-runner` service identity against Corvid Gateway, and the token is injected via the `LF_INDEX_TOKEN` env var in the scheduler config. Nothing clever going on, just a bearer header on every batch request. For review purposes, the staging credential currently in use is listed below.

service key, kadug-kadup: kto15_rN23XLAYImmZgrJ

Night shift: visitors are not to access the pool-car key cabinet under any circumstances. The cabinet by the loading dock at Marrow House is for Veltrix staff only. Escort all after-hours visitors to the waiting area and log them in the register. If a visitor requests a pool car, refuse and refer them to day reception. Unlock the cabinet using the pass below.

door code, kawip-bagap: bdg-HQEWH-4